Can I make pancakes or waffles without buttermilk?
Yes. Start with Milk + Lemon Juice at 1 cup milk + 1 tbsp lemon juice, let sit 5 minutes. The acid curdles the milk, mimicking buttermilk's acidity and thickness.
Choose alternatives that hold batter consistency and help keep a light interior. These batters are sensitive to liquid ratios and acidity, both of which affect fluffiness and browning.

Top options are Milk + Lemon Juice (1 cup milk + 1 tbsp lemon juice, let sit 5 minutes) plus Milk + Vinegar (1 cup milk + 1 tbsp white vinegar, let sit 5 minutes) and Yogurt + Water (3/4 cup yogurt + 1/4 cup water).
